We are recruiting a committed and experienced 1:1 SEN Teaching Assistant to support a Year 8 pupil within a mainstream secondary school in Stockport. This is a long-term, full-time position supporting a student with SEND and significant behavioural needs.
Due to the school's location, the site is difficult to access via public transport, therefore drivers are strongly preferred.
The Role
* Providing dedicated 1:1 support to a Year 8 student
* Supporting learning, emotional regulation, and behaviour management
* Applying Team Teach strategies and positive handling techniques where required
* Working collaboratively with teaching staff, SENCO, and pastoral teams
* Supporting the pupil both in class and during unstructured times
Essential Requirements
* Level 3 Teaching Assistant qualification or relevant UK Bachelor Degree
* Previous experience working with children or young people with SEN, particularly those with behavioural challenges
* Team Teach training is highly desirable (or significant experience using positive handling strategies)
* Strong behaviour management skills and a calm, consistent approach
* Enhanced DBS on the Update Service, or willingness to pay for a new DBS
* Ability to provide references covering the last 2 years
